Safeguarding the Elegance of Limestone Countertops

Limestone countertops bring a timeless elegance to any kitchen or bathroom. Their natural variations in color and texture form a truly unique aesthetic. However, these tops are also absorbent, making them prone to damage if not properly cared for.

Regular cleaning is essential for enhancing the luster of your limestone countertops. Stay check here away from using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ners, as these can mar the surface. Instead, opt for a gentle cleaner specifically intended for natural stone.

After washing, be sure to thoroughly dry your countertops with a lint-free cloth to stop water marks. Occasionally, apply a sealing product to help guard the stone from acids.
